SALUKIS DOWN INDIANS IN ANNUAL ROTARY CLASSIC GAME

red-hill-saluki

The Red Hill basketball Salukis picked up their third win over the Lawrenceville Indians Tuesday night winning the annual Rotary Midwinter Classic game during Pack the Place night in Bridgeport. They broke open a close game in the fourth quarter with a little offensive spurt enroute to a 61-49 victory. The Salukis led by 1 after one quarter, were tied at the half at 28 and led by three after three before notching their second straight win. Drew Moore led the way with 20 points while Corbin Shoulders added 11. For the Indians, who lost their sixth game in a row, Zeus Marsh scored 13 and Cale Powell added 10 off the bench. Red Hill also won the JV game 59-49 with Blake Allen scoring 21 points and Landen Ray 11 while Powell had 17 and Skyler Tewell 12 for the Tribe. With the win, the Salukis improve to 10-12 while the struggling Indians fall to 4-18. The Salukis are back in action Wednesday night as they host the Paris Tigers in a rescheduled conference game.  The Indians will host Casey Friday.
